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Extraction

Catching attic water extraction problems early on can save you a world of stress and expense.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Is your attic smelling musty or mildewy, but you can’t seem to get rid of the smell no matter how much you clean? This could be a sign of moisture in your attic. Check for water stains on the ceiling or walls, and check your gutters and downspouts to make sure they’re clear.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Are you noticing water stains on your ceiling or walls? This could be a sign of a leak in your roof or a clogged gutter. Check your gutters and downspouts to make sure they’re clear, and consider hiring a professional to inspect your roof for any dam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Is your paint or wallpaper starting to peel or bubble? This could be a sign of moisture in your attic. Check for water stains on the ceiling or walls, and consider hiring a professional to inspect your attic for any dam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Is your flooring starting to warp or buckle? This could be a sign of moisture in your attic. Check for water stains on the ceiling or walls, and consider hiring a professional to inspect your attic for any damage.

Visible Water Damage

Is there visible water damage in your attic, like water stains or warped wood? This is a clear sign that you need attic water extraction. Don’t try to handle it yourself – call a professional to get the job done right.

Attic Water Extraction Cost In Watkins Glen, NY

The cost of attic water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the area. Our prices start at $500 and can go up to $2,500 or more, depending on the job.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Inspection and Assessment $100 – $300 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Water Removal $500 – $2,000 Amount of water, complexity of job
Drying and Dehumidification $300 – $1,500 Size of affected area, complexity of job
Cleaning and Sanitizing $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of job
Equipment Rental $100 – $500 Amount of time needed, complexity of job
Free Estimate $0 – $100 Size of affected area, complexity of job
